我正在尝试找到一种方法以 Angular 从日期格式中转义单词并将结果显示为:2016-12-23 23:59 GMT
.当我使用下一个代码时
'date:"yyyy-MM-dd HH:mm":"GMT"'
Angular 显示日期没有任何问题,但没有 GMT 字样。但是我试图传递一个词“GMT”并逃避它,
'date:"yyyy-MM-dd HH:mm":"GMT" \"GMT\"'
我收到语法错误。
我在 ui-grid 中用作 cellFilter 的这种日期格式并从 Controller 设置。 This is plunker我的问题
我的错误在哪里?
最佳答案
您可以将转义字符串传递到格式日期字符串中,如下所示:
cellFilter: 'date:"yyyy-MM-dd HH:mm \'GMT\'":"GMT"'
结果:http://plnkr.co/edit/0FbYfjehnNo26Fw8wKva?p=preview
关于javascript - 如何从日期格式angularjs中转义单词,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/40597879/